Accounts Payable/Receivable Analyst jobs in the United States

Accounts Payable/Receivable Analyst analyzes accounts payable/receivable activities to ensure compliance with internal controls and accounting policies. Maintains and reconciles the accounts payable and accounts receivable ledger to validate charges and ensure timely and accurate payments and receipt of payments. Being an Accounts Payable/Receivable Analyst utilizes AP/AR data to identify trends, inefficiencies, and opportunities for improvements or cost savings. Generates reports to bring insight into collections, account ages, and other relevant metrics and relays conclusions to management. Additionally, Accounts Payable/Receivable Analyst investigates and resolves discrepancies in billings and collections or payments. Analyzes customer credit history, determines credit risk, and recommends credit limits and payment terms. May recommend improvements to accounts payable/receivable processes. Requires a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a manager. The Accounts Payable/Receivable Analyst occasionally directed in several aspects of the work. Gaining exposure to some of the complex tasks within the job function. To be an Accounts Payable/Receivable Analyst typically requires 2-4 years of related exper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

    POSITION SUMMARY:

    This position will be responsible for customer accounts in Accounts Receivable. This involves researching outstanding items and contacting customers. This position will be preparing A/R reports and conducting A/R meetings with accounting leadership to help determine the best course of action.

    Essential Duties and Responsibilities

    • Evaluates outstanding balances of customer accounts to determine best course of action.
    •  Actions may involve directly contacting customers to inquire as to non-payment of past due items and/or resolving differences between customer data and Energy Transfer data.
    • Determines collectability of past due items. If a receivable is deemed to be uncollectable, the A/R Analyst presents the recommendation to management and the decision is made whether or not to write-off the uncollectable item.
    • Contact customers to receive payment detail when necessary.
    • Apply any credit memos to associated invoices.
    • Confer with Plant Accounting to reconcile aged items in customer accounts.
    • Contact customers regarding late payments, inquiring as to payment status. Forward missing invoices to customers.
    • Create check requests for returning overpayments.
    • Work with Plant Accounting regarding possible netting of A/P against A/R.
    • Submit semi-monthly aging report to management containing comments for items over 60 days. Report is reviewed by VP and Controller, Assistant Controller - Midstream, Manager - Accounts Receivable, and Plant Accounting management.
    • Conduct A/R meetings twice monthly. Discuss with management and staff as to status of customer collections per A/R Aging reports
    • Perform any follow-up duties as addressed in meetings.
    • Prepare monthly A/R recon reports, identifying and explaining significant outstanding items.
